Taxonomic Classification

Rank Mouse bandicoot Willow Leaf Beetle
Kingdom same Animalia (Animals)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um Chordata (Chordates) Arthropoda (Arthropods)
Class Mammalia (Mammals) Insecta (Insects)
Order Peramelemorphia (Peramelemorphia) Coleoptera (Beetles)
Family Peramelidae Chrysomelidae
Genus Microperoryctes Lochmaea
Species Microperoryctes murina Lochmaea caprea

Evolutionary Relationship

Mouse bandicoot and Willow Leaf Beetle share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
